Reading enhancement for 9-year-olds is crucial because this age marks a significant stage in child development where foundational literacy skills are established. Effective reading skills not only contribute to academic success but also encourage a lifelong love of learning. At nine, children transition from “learning to read” to “reading to learn,” a jump that sets the stage for their understanding of more complex subjects across the curriculum.

Parents and teachers should prioritize reading enhancement to foster critical thinking, vocabulary development, and comprehension skills. Enhancing reading proficiency can lead to better performance in all areas of education, as literacy is foundational for subjects like math, science, and social studies.

Additionally, improved reading abilities can boost confidence and self-esteem, enabling children to express themselves more effectively. Engaging in reading activities also promotes bonding between parents and children, making reading a shared adventure that enriches family experiences.

Finally, children who develop strong reading habits are better equipped for future educational challenges and life opportunities. In a world increasingly driven by information, ensuring that children can navigate texts fluently prepares them for success both inside and outside the classroom. Investing in reading enhancement is an investment in a child's future.
